Evergreen Education Foundation Programs:
|
Evergreen Education Foundation's main program is its Rural High
School Library Program.
For participating rural high school libraries, our goal is to provide
assistance to:
-
Develop an appropriate collection profile that fits the
community and provide funds for the purchase of books and periodicals.
-
Identify and purchase appropriate computer hard/software for
the operation of the library.
-
Provide training workshops on the use of technology for the
librarians.
-
Provide information literacy workshops for faculty, students
and the general public.
To complement our library program, Evergreen has established a
Scholarship Program for middle and senior high school students at the targeted
schools and nearby communities. Our students are expected to provide some
service to the community. Students at our library program schools are expected
to volunteer as assistants in the library. Some students in minority areas are
expected to borrow books from the library to help teach their parents how read
in the summer months, etc. An important part of the design of the scholarship
program is our group of mentors. The mentors correspond with individual
students and provide warmth and guidance to our students and to our program
committee with valuable input.
